DYNO Plumbing T20 competition now open for entries

Applications for this year’s DYNO Plumbing T20 are now open for the 2020 season.

To celebrate the 150th Year of Kent Cricket, the Club is delighted to announce that this year’s Final will take place under floodlights at The Spitfire Ground, St. Lawrence, the home of Kent Cricket.

The ‘DYNO T20’ is for cricket clubs looking to reinvigorate participation and is open to Kent-based village clubs, and clubs in Division 2 or below in the Kent League.

Its unique rules are aimed at a different demographic of club players, whether that is lapsed players, new to the game players, or using the competition to encourage Under-18s to stay in the game.

Last year’s winners of the DYNO T20 were Bromley Town CC. Read the full story here >>>

DYNO T20 Finals Day will take place at The Spitfire Ground on Saturday 12th September 2020 from 11:00am, with the Final taking place under lights.

Kent Cricket’s Community Director, Andy Griffiths, said: “Kent is blessed to have such a high number of active cricket clubs and this is a fantastic tournament to help get younger players get into, and stay into, cricket at a participatory level.

“The number of clubs entering increases year on year and it gives players an opportunity to participate in a short format of the game and to test their skill level.

“DYNO has been a fantastic sponsor and has helped us once again raise the profile of recreational cricket in Kent.”
